Chhattisgarh: 3 labourers dead after soil cave-in during pipeline work in Balod
India, May 13 -- Three labourers were killed after being buried under soil while laying a sewer pipeline in Chhattisgarh's Balod district on Tuesday evening, officials said.
The incident occurred around 6.30pm near Das Paan Thela Chowk in Rajhara town, where work on a Bhilai Steel Plant (BSP) sewerage pipeline project was underway.
According to officials, six labourers were working inside a pit nearly seven feet deep when the loose soil suddenly caved in, trapping them under the debris.
Rescue teams managed to pull out three workers alive, while the remaining three died before they could be rescued.
The deceased were identified as Kishun Kumar, Rakesh Kumar and a woman labourer identified as Baishakhin.
